Maseno University Students Shot by Gunmen in World Cup Finals Night Out

Two University students were on Sunday night attacked by unknown gunmen when leaving a popular entertainment joint after watching the 2018 World Cup final match.

The attackers shot the two Maseno University students at Nyawita area near the institution's Siriba Campus.

Kisumu West OCPD Wilston Mwakio has confirmed the attack stating that no arrests have been made yet.

“The two students were shot in Nyawita, an area behind the University’s Siriba Campus. The incident occurred a few moments after the World Cup final match which a number of the students were watching. They shot the students and took away their phones,”  Mwakio confirmed to Kenyans.co.ke.

Eugine Ndombi and one identified as Vincent, who are second and third-year students at the institution, are receiving treatment at the Jaramogi Oginga Odinga Teaching and Referral Hospital in Kisumu following the incident.

The student’s union chairperson Mike Odoyo who accompanied them to the hospital confirmed the two have gunshot injuries.

One suffered on the arm while the other was shot in the chest with the bullet going into his arm.

“We are saddened to learn of the incident that happened at Nyawita last evening. Students were from watching the World Cup finals and they were attacked and robbed by thugs. We are awaiting x~rays results to ascertain the nature of their injuries,” regretted Odoyo.

Mr Mwakio stated that the attackers are believed to have fled to the neighboring Luanda market in Vihiga County.
